Men's Hockey Defeated By Maine, 5-3

3/9/2000 12:00:00 AM | Men's Ice Hockey

Box Score

ORONO, Maine -- The Maine Black Bears defeated Providence College, 5-3, in the first game of the HOCKEY EAST best-of-three Quarterfinal Series on Thursday, March 9 at Alfond Arena in Orono, Maine.

The Black Bears took a 1-0 lead at 3:33 of the first period when Jim Leger took a rebound off a blocked shot and skated the length of the ice before wristing a high shot past Friar netminder Boyd Ballard. The Friars evened the game at 13:28 of the first period when Matt Libby broke down the left wing and fired a pass towards the front of the net that deflected off a Maine player past Black Bear goaltender Matt Yeats.

Maine took advantage of its first power-play opportunity to take a 2-1 lead when Niko Dimitrakos wristed in a rebound through a screen at the 5:58 mark of the second period. The Black Bears built on their lead at 9:02 of the second period when Ben Guite tipped a shot past Ballard. Maine continued to hurt the Friars on the power play as Guite again redirected a shot past Ballard at 12:53 of the second period. After Maine's fourth goal, PC regrouped and scored two goals to close the period, trailing 4-3. Fernando Pisani netted his 14th goal of the season for the Friars at 15:57 after finishing off a two-on-one break in. The Friars' Jon DiSalvatore closed out the scoring in the period as he snapped a shot in from the left faceoff circle at the 16:39 mark.

Maine's Brendan Walsh added a power-play empty net goal of 19:40 of the third period to seal the win for Maine.

With the win, Maine improved to 23-7-5 overall, while Providence fell to 18-17-2 overall.

The Friars and the Black Bears will return to action on Friday, March 10 in the second game of the Quarterfinal Series at Alfond Arena at 7:00 p.m.
